How they compare
Senegal currently reports 302,380 against 285,060 in Chad, a difference of 17,320.
That makes Senegal's figure about 1.1 times Chad's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 66 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Chad ahead.
Chad ranks 84th and Senegal ranks 83rd of 217 countries.
Across the 7 decades both report, Chad averaged higher in 1 and Senegal in 6.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Chad | Senegal |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 61,764 | 61,046 | 717.8 | Chad |
| 1970s | 71,249 | 78,542 | 7,292 | Senegal |
| 1980s | 77,116 | 99,055 | 21,939 | Senegal |
| 1990s | 85,254 | 122,220 | 36,966 | Senegal |
| 2000s | 119,934 | 154,668 | 34,734 | Senegal |
| 2010s | 180,280 | 205,431 | 25,150 | Senegal |
| 2020s | 252,411 | 275,723 | 23,312 | Senegal |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
